The ISY log only records status changes

To view events you would have to open the (real time) event viewer and set it to level 3

Not sure why you're not retaining your theme.  If you're running Norton Security it runs a performance routine that deletes temp files which may affect your theme.

The ISY Log only records changes in status sent from devices. Scene commands do not respond and therefore have no record in the Log.

I once found an OnOff plug-in, totally involved in any scene, sending out "scene on" messages in response to Off commands from ISY. The error Log showed some bad messages from it at the approximate times when it happened. Simply unplugging the OnOff module stopped  it. Been good over a year  now.

Regarding the scaling issues, this worked for me on Windows 10 + Java 8:

1. Find the Java web start executable:

Right click on ISY Launcher shortcut
More > Open file location
In the explorer window right click on ISY Launcher
Open file location

javaws.exe in your JRE should be selected

2. Change DPI scaling behavior from Application to System:

Right click on javaws.exe
Properties > Compatibility > Change high DPI settings
Check "Override high DPI scaling behavior. Scaling performed by:"
Select "System"

As far as I know, Java 9 should scale correctly without scaling performed by system.
